, or Krong Khemarak Phoumin, is the capital of Province in . It is 8 km from Cham Yeam, which is connected by Cambodia's southernmost border crossing to the Thai town of .

is the location of the southern-most border crossing between and . Its Cambodian counterpart is Cham Yeam, about 8 km from .
